The Raven

Today I saw a Raven
Sitting on a hollow limb
He tried to fly through my window
But my window wouldn't allow death in
Then he flew back to the tree
Anger filled his coal black eyes
I don't believe he will be leaving
Until someone here has died
The Raven flies with the Reaper
Roaming earth in search of death
As long as the Raven flies
On mankind the Reaper will fest
